skylot / jadx

Dex to Java decompiler
Apache License 2.0
41.89k stars 4.89k forks source link

[core] Protected apps and published programs cannot be opened or viewed #2337

Open ghost opened 2 weeks ago

ghost commented 2 weeks ago

Issue details

Protective https://github.com/luoyesiqiu/dpt-shell

release https://github.com/bdvajstudio/javdb

Relevant log output or stacktrace

No response

Provide sample and class/method full name

No response

Jadx version

1.5.0

jpstotz commented 2 weeks ago

@ghost Can you please describe a bit more what can not be opened. You have provided two links to github projects. I assume you are referring to one of their release, but which file inside their release ZIP? Also what does Protective and release mean? Can the one be opened by jadx and the other not - or both do not work?

DataM0del commented 1 week ago

I think they meant Protector instead of Protective, and release is the linked repository's release that was processed by the Protector.

jpstotz commented 2 days ago

@ghost If you have such a protected APK please rename it to .zip and attach it to this issue. Then we can see what problems it causes in Jadx.